A Mexican bakery that also sells savory German pastries called bierocks are a savory soft pastry filled with meat and veggies. I was so excited to see these in the case and double excited to see the different flavor styles offered and influenced by the surrounding neighborhood. They had classic bierocks with ground beef and cabbage, cheese with jalapeño, chorizo, and carne asada. I bought one of each! These were not quite like the ones I had as a kid, but still very good. I loved all the fillings, but my favorite was a Carne Asada with cheese. Their classic cabbage and ground beef bierock was a little bland. The chorizo was delish and all that soft bread was the perfect grease absorber. From what I was told, they sell bierocks because this bakery used to be owned by an old German couple who retired and sold it to a Mexican family. The original owners asked if they would keep these traditional German treats on the menu for their loyal customers who still lived in the neighborhood. Since then, they have gone on to keep the traditional alive while adding their own flavor and style, which I think is amazing!
